Caspase-7, Apoptosis-related cysteine peptidase, is a human protein encoded by the CASP7 gene. CASP7 orthologs have been identified in nearly all mammals for which complete genome data are available. It is a member of the caspase (cysteine aspartate protease) family of proteins, and has been shown to be an executioner protein of apoptosis. Using radiation hybrid mapping, the gene was localized to human chromosome 10q25.1-q25.2. The orderly activation of CASP7 regulates microglia activation through a protein kinase C-delta (PRKCD)-dependent pathway.
Optimal dilution of the Caspase-7 antibody should be determined by the researcher.
Amino acids 117-198 of human Caspase-7 were used as the immunogen for the Caspase-7 antibody. This sequence is from the large subunit.
After reconstitution, the Caspase-7 antibody can be stored for up to one month at 4oC. For long-term, aliquot and store at -20oC. Avoid repeated freezing and thawing.
